Online program configures in just a few clicks

EAST PROVIDENCE, R.I. - January 29, 2009 - igus® Inc. has announced the launch of a new E-Chain® Configurator program, which enables users to quickly custom build a cable carrier with cables and internal separators online. The user can then generate CAD files and a parts list, or submit a quote request directly to igus.

The program is designed to fill the company's E-Chain cable carriers, which were developed to guide and protect moving cables on automated machinery. Interior separators, shelves, cables and hoses can be virtually installed in a few clicks. A complete Energy Chain System® can be configured in just minutes.

Simply choose the type, inner width, bending radius and length of cable carrier you require. On the second screen, you can drag and drop side plates, separators and spacers into the interactive chain link. The bending radius, length and quantity of cables and hoses can also be entered, before being pulled into the cross section with your cursor.

The cable carrier configurator is designed to be as simple as possible. An integrated control device does not allow component parts to be dragged into the chain link anywhere they will not work. This avoids the potential for error. The igus technical team is also always on hand to work on later optimizations to the generated configuration, if required.

About igus
igus Inc., founded in 1985 and based in East Providence, R.I., develops and manufactures industry-leading plastic cable carriers, continuous-flex cables, plastic bearings and linear guide systems. With more than 70,000 products available from stock, the company meets the motion control and machinery component needs of customers worldwide. Product lines include Energy Chain Systems® to protect and house moving cables, Chainflex® continuous-flex cables, iglide® self-lubricating, oil-free, plastic bearings, DryLin® linear guide systems and igubal® spherical bearings.
